Nuclear Energy States ofIn115

Abstract
The gamma rays of Cd115 and Cd115m have been investigated by means of scintillation counting and coincidence methods. The K-shell conversion coefficient of the 34-keV gamma ray is measured to be 3.43±0.12, suggesting the transition to be E1 in character and that the 858-keV level in the nucleus of In115 has positive parity. The gamma rays at 635, 650, and 890 keV which have been reported in the decay of Cd115m are shown to emanate from Ag110m, present as an impurity.
